2019-09-09conf/layer.conf: use BBFILES_DYNAMIC for dynamic layersRobert Yang
The previous code add all BBFILE_COLLECTIONS/recipes*/*/*.bbappend to BBFILES, which causes the parsing very slow when there are many layers, e.g., I have 87 layers: * Before: $ rm -fr tmp-glibc/ cache; time bitbake -p real 0m45.173s user 0m0.560s sys 0m0.060s * After: $ rm -fr tmp-glibc/ cache; time bitbake -p real 0m25.542s user 0m0.572s sys 0m0.040s It wasted 20s which wasn't worth (The host has 128 threads, it should cost more time on less power host), use BBFILES_DYNAMIC can fix the problem. 2016-04-04refpolicy: Setup virtual/refpolicy provider.Philip Tricca
This allows us to provide a default policy through the PREFERRED_PROVIDER mechanism for each of the example distro configs. Consumers of meta-selinux will be able to override this at the config level instead of having to depend on a specific policy package. We do lose the ability install more than one policy package but this falls in line with the embedded nature of the project. 2013-09-23Add leading whitespace to DISTRO_FEATURES_append in oe-selinux.confPhilip Tricca
The lack of leading whitespace was causing two values in the DISTRO_FEATURES variable to be combined. This was causing 'sysvinit' from DISTRO_FEATURES_BACKFILL and 'pam' (from oe-selinux) to be combined into 'sysvinitpam' thus dropping both from the DISTRO_FEATURES.
